Twelve years ago, Congress passed the Historical Memory Act of 2007, with the president of the Spanish Government, José Luis Zapatero, of the PSOE. This is the law on which this disobedience is based. Since then, Congress passed a non-legislative proposal authorizing the departure of Franco and, finally, the Spanish Government gave its mandate in 2019.
The foundations closest to the family, however, have not taken long to obstruct order in the courts. With all the doors open, on Thursday they will take the dictator from the Valley of the Fallen to the pantheon of Mingorrubio, where his widow, Carmen Polo, is buried.
